Output 576b58852d407b38fa57c806071e3576b529c2807b23704f1a8f9cc686bdfbbc:39

value
806749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d5dd7a82dbe7c94761a0728d6ece25740570930 OP_EQUAL
address
3AChBfkYqQiu3MWngXuy94y7rq1WV9Svwp
transaction
576b58852d407b38fa57c806071e3576b529c2807b23704f1a8f9cc686bdfbbc
spent
true